 North Star BlueScope Steel is a 50-50 joint venture
North Star BlueScope Steel is a 50-50 joint venture between BlueScope Steel (Melbourne, Australia) and Cargill, Inc. (Minneapolis, MN). BlueScope Steel is Australia’s largest steel producer. The company also is known worldwide for its coated and painted steel products with facilities in Australia, Asia and North America. In 2004, BlueScope Steel acquired Butler Manufacturing, the leading pre-engineered steel buildings manufacturer in the United States and China.

Cargill, Inc. is America’s largest private company, the world’s largest grain trader and food processing company.  The company has over 80,000 employees working in 65 countries throughout the world.
The partnership brings together expertise in electric furnace steel making, slab casting and hot rolling technology in a synchronous flat rolled mini-mill.  The steel mill is designed with a unique combination of proven technology to provide our customers a superior hot rolled product.

The facility was built in 1995 and 1996 with coil production beginning in March, 1997.  In a short period of time, the Employees of North Star BlueScope Steel have achieved remarkable success.  Some of the significant accomplishments include:

  • Achieving 3 years and 4 months without a Lost-Time Injury.

  • Winner of the 2004 Governors Excellence Award for Workers Compensation and Safety.

  • Ranked the #1 supplier four consecutive times by an independent survey (Jacobsen and Associates). This ranking included being #1 in Delivery Performance, Quality, Customer Service and Overall Satisfaction against all other Flat rolled steel producers in North America!

  • Production of 2 million tons of steel in a plant with a design capacity of 1.5 million tons.

  • World Class Plant-wide Attendance – The Employees have averaged over 99.30% attendance over the past 5 years. We do not know of any other production facility with this level of performance.

  • 2004 Community Service Award presented by the Steel Manufacturers Association (SMA).
